All about undefined

Interested in learning more?

  • 15833 6196

    715 29103348 95405389238

    See more
  • 0436 612 3064

    060 16827872 37872801263

    See more
  • 1803 61711 916251913

    76618 53186596739 5536301 9613960895 012601271

    See more